Description

Job Title - Patient Service Representative
Job Location - White Plains, NY
Job Duration - 4+ Months
Shift/Time Zone: M-F 9-5:30pm


Job Summary:
  • Answers and resolves telephone inquiries/requests initiated by customers or prospective customers in a prompt, accurate and courteous manner.
  • Use proper telephone etiquette and all available resources to respond to incoming customer inquiries, requests and complaints competently and courteously.
  • Troubleshoot inquiries and follow up with customers on issues that cannot be resolved immediately.
  • Complete all required documentation associated with the handling of calls and maintain complete and accurate records.
  • Report laboratory results to clients and patients using established protocols.
  • Follow through in a timely manner to resolve all issues and concerns.
  • Provide education and guidance to clients about lab processes.
  • Escalate issues as appropriate to keep supervisor informed of client concerns, problems or deviations from established procedures.
  • Perform other duties as assigned to meet the business needs or customer requirements. This is not an exhaustive list of all duties and responsibilities, but rather a general description of work performed by the position.
